Alexander Olch Cotton-Chambray Braces
Alexander Olch has sourced some of the finest English-woven cotton-chambray for this pair of suspenders, which has been crafted by hand in New York city, USA. A less-common sartorial edition in recent years, braces like these take a certain amount of confidence to wear to their full potential.
Alexander Olch Slim Striped Linen Tie
Smartly patterned with contrasting stripes of blue and off-white, this Alexander Olch tie will effortlessly enliven your tailored looks & bring a welcome warm-weather style to any suit. Made with a summer-weight linen fabric, its texture and palette work particularly well with a seersucker blazer for that effortlessly fashionable look.

Alexander Olch Plaid Round Handkerchief
There’s something to be said for simplicity, and Alexander Olch says it well with this plain round handkerchief. A linen handkerchief in a brown gingham check, hand made in Belgium, this is a great bit addition to any summer suit. Available online now.
